Here is a short list of common SOFTSKILLS needed in many jobs.
Customer Service—understands and meets customer needs fully
Interpersonal Skills—deals with a diverse range of people effectively
Planning—plans and organizes own and others' work to meet requirements
Written communications—writes clearly, identifies critical information needed and presents it to achieve desired goals
Oral communications—speaks clearly and effectively, tailors message to audience needs to achieve understanding, presents well to groups.
Listening skills—listens intently to understand others' ideas and views
Integrity—recognized for positive ethical approach, behaves consistently with values
Initiative—self-starter, makes good suggestions
Flexibility—deals with change or ambiguity without increasing stress or creating additional problems
Problem-solving—effectively assesses and resolves problems
Coping skills—handles difficult situations and people effectively
Teamwork—works well with others to achieve desired results
Leadership—creates effective teamwork, encourages others to achieve
Conflict resolution—able to identify underlying problem, reach out to others involved, offer solutions for differences
Sales Ability --sell ideas / concepts.
Negotiation---able to position / bargain/ make deals.
Presentation skills--making effective presentation of solutions.
Making judgements -- choosing between the alternatives.
Analyse - making analysis of situations
